    What: Hong Kong Airlines Airbus A330-200 en route from Hong Kong to Beijing
    Where: Changsa
    When: Mar 9th 2012
    Why: While en route, the flight developed a loss of cabin pressure.

    Oxygen masks were deployed.

    Pilots diverted to Changsa where they made a safe landing.

    Door Ripped from SAS Airbus


    On Jan 25, 2013, a Scandinavian Airlines SAS Airbus A320-232 with 150 aboard was at Gardermoen airport Norway loaded with passengers to Copenhagen when the SAS plane rolled backwards while it still was parked at gate 44. The door to the plane was ripped from its hinges.

    Both the street and the plane were damaged.

    Passengers were provided alternative flights. The crew and airport hope, optimistically, that the damaged can be handled expeditiously.

    An investigation of how this could happen is underway.

    Thomas Cook Airlines Flight Makes Emergency Landing in Munich

    Thomas Cook Airlines flight MT-992 made an emergency landing in Munich, Germany, on October 15th.

    The Airbus A321-200 plane heading from Birmingham, England, to Hurghada, Egypt, was diverted after the crew reported an issue with a fuel pump.

    The plane landed uneventfully. Everyone aboard remained safe.

    Air France Plane Makes Emergency Landing in Russia

    Air FranceAir France flight 275 had to make an emergency landing in Khabarovsk, Russia, on June 2.

    The Boeing 777, heading from Tokyo to Paris, was diverted after one of its engines failed.

    The plane landed uneventfully.

    All 275 passengers and 17 crew members remained safe.

    Eurowings Flight Makes Emergency Landing due to Smoke in Cockpit

    Eurowings flight EW-7778 had to return and make an emergency landing in Hamburg, Germany, on September 14th.

    The Airbus A319-100 plane took off for Prague, Czech Republic, but had to turn back after the crew noticed smoke in the cockpit.

    The plane landed back safely. All passengers and crew members remained unharmed.

    Edelweiss Air Flight Makes Emergency Landing in Zurich

    Edelweiss Air flight WK-176 had to return and make an emergency landing in Zurich, Switzerland, on July 2nd.

    The Airbus A320-200 plane took off for Antalya, Turkey, but had to turn back after the crew needed to shut down one of the engines.

    The plane landed back safely. There were one hundred and sixty-six passengers and six crew members aboard at the time; all of them remained unharmed.
